Before starting a survey it is important that you have read the soft guidelines for use of NOSACQ-50 and inform the participants.
The information about the survey to the participants can be given verbally or through other media (e-mail, internet, article/noticein a company paper). The information should include the following aspects:
-
Why the survey is being carried through
-
Which groups in the company are participating
-
That participation is voluntary – but the higher participation rate the more acurate the results
-
That participants fill in the questionnaire anonymously
-
That reporting of the results are in anonymous form
-
Procedures for how the results will be used
Prior to filling out the survey the participants should be given a short instruction on how to fill in the questionnaire, including:
-
Read the instructions on page 1 and 2 of the questionnaire
-
Read the questions carefully – some items are reversed/negated
-
Be sure to answer all questions – even though some questions may appear very similar
